Lightning kills one, injures two

From Our Correspondent

 KHLIEHRIAT: A coal labourer identified as Rajul Islam Barbhuya (19) of Cachar District, Assam was killed on the spot while two other coal labourers were critically injured when a lightning struck their labour camp at Jalaphet village in East Jaintia hills on Saturday night. Sources said that the three coal labourers were sleeping inside their camp when the lightning struck at around 10 pm. The injured were rushed to Khliehriat CHC and later shifted to a Hospital in Silchar. The deceased was handed over to relatives after a post-mortem examination was conducted.
